
Pope meets with Rome priests, promises them his prayers daily
Published: 2005-05-13
R0ME (CNS) -- While apologizing that he cannot have the personal relationship with each of the priests of the Diocese of Rome that other bishops have with their priests, Pope Benedict XVI promised them his prayers daily. Pope Benedict spent almost two hours May 13 with the priests of the diocese in the Basilica of St. John Lateran, his diocesan cathedral. Seated behind a large wood table, with his glasses perched on the end of his nose, he read his prepared text, but also frequently raised his eyes from the text to explain a point in more detail. Rome, he said, "is a truly special diocese because of the universal care with which the Lord has entrusted its bishop. Therefore, your relationship, dear priests, with your diocesan bishop cannot have that daily immediacy that is possible in other situations."
